Output 2c583f666c3b7984b2510b5d995ca7bdb6ff370e40fa520177eac780f4bae3ca:0

value
64559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ab0c32346be40d7172865c2939b4136f060ffc OP_EQUAL
address
3Dy5Nr7BbjgN3BXqyfakZ8dUN4Xq2CJDqX
transaction
2c583f666c3b7984b2510b5d995ca7bdb6ff370e40fa520177eac780f4bae3ca
confirmations
224270
spent
true